基于ANSYS-PDS的矫直机工作辊可靠性分析

摘    要:在可靠性分析理论基础下,运用有限元ANSYS的PDS模块对矫直机工作辊进行可靠性分析。根据应力-强度干涉理论,以工作辊的几何尺寸、载荷及强度极限等参数作为变量,建立极限状态函数;选用Monte Carlo方法对工作辊进行计算,得到工作辊的可靠度、灵敏度图及影响可靠性的主要因素。

Reliability Analysis of Leveling Rolls of Roll Leveler Based on ANSYS-PDS

Abstract:Based on the theory of reliability analysis, the reliability of the roll leveler is analyzed by using the ANSYS-PDS in this paper. According to stress-strength interference theory, taking the geometry size, load and strength limit as random varia- bles, and the function of limit state is created. Using the method of Monte Carlo simulation to calculate working rolls, and the reliability, the response sensitivity and the main factors that affecting the reliability are got.
